Protein crystallography data

The structure of Myo-Inositol 3-Kinase Bound with Its Products (Adp and 1D-Myo-Inositol 3-Phosphate), PDB code: 4xf6 was solved by R.Nagata, M.Fujihashi, K.Miki,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 40.66 / 2.08
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 77.364, 81.255, 82.046, 90.00, 90.00, 90.00
R / Rfree (%) 20.3 / 25
